nxosv9k703i74qcow2 refers to a specific virtual disk image file—nxosv9k-7.0.3.i7.4.qcow2—used to run the Cisco Nexus 9000v (N9Kv) virtual switch. This image allows engineers to simulate the control plane of high-performance Cisco Nexus switches within virtualized environments like EVE-NG, GNS3, or KVM/QEMU for testing, automation, and training purposes. - Lab/testing of NX‑OS features (fabric, VXLAN, ACI interop, automation).
- Development and CI pipelines that validate network configurations.
- Training and demos without physical Nexus hardware.
